[General anesthesia in patients with spontaneous respiration]

Summary
A new total intravenous anesthesia technique using microdoses of medications offers advantages over traditional methods for cancer surgery patients. This safe and effective approach ensures rapid recovery and is suitable for mass casualty events.
Area of Science:
- Anesthesiology
- Surgical Oncology
- Pharmacology
Background:
- Current anesthesia methods for extracavity surgery can have drawbacks.
- Preserving spontaneous respiration is a key consideration in patient management.
- Evaluating novel anesthetic techniques is crucial for improving patient outcomes.
Observation:
- Experimental studies in rats and clinical trials in 930 cancer patients were conducted.
- The study focused on a total intravenous anesthesia (TIVA) technique with microdoses of diazepam, fentanyl, calypsol, and droperidol.
- Patients maintained spontaneous respiration throughout the procedure.
Findings:
- The elaborated TIVA technique demonstrated advantages over inhalation and traditional intravenous anesthesia.
- Key benefits include technical simplicity, high efficacy, and rapid postanesthetic rehabilitation.
- The technique showed safety for healthcare personnel and economic advantages.
Implications:
- This TIVA method offers a safe and effective alternative for cancer surgery patients.
- Its minimal impact on vital functions and ability to maintain spontaneous breathing make it suitable for mass casualty incidents.
- The technique's simplicity and lack of need for special equipment enhance its applicability in diverse settings.
